At War at Sea by Ronald H Spector

Traces the story (from 1905 to 2002) of the world's great navies and the crews that manned them. In a series of set pieces, Ronald Spector brings to life the battles that have defined the modern age; from giant battles such as Jutland and Midway to the "routine" terrors of the U-Boat wars. Also depicted are harrowing naval encounters such as the British evacuation of Crete or the American "river war" in Vietnam.
Ronald Spector is the author most recently of the award-winning Eagle Against The Sun: The American War Against Japan and is Professor of History and International Relations at George Washington University, Washington, D.C.
